Veiled Vengeance: The Heeled Avenger

The moonlight bathed the cobblestone streets of the ancient city of Liang, casting long, silvery shadows. The night was still, save for the occasional rustle of leaves in the wind. In the heart of this quiet town, a figure moved with a grace that belied the clack of her high heels against the stone. She was the High Heel Heroine, a name whispered in fear and awe among the populace.

Her name was Li, a woman who had lived in the shadows for years, her presence known only to a select few. She had once been a revered martial artist, her skills unparalleled. But her world had crumbled when her beloved mentor was framed for a crime he did not commit. In a fit of rage and grief, Li had vowed to bring her mentor's name back to its rightful place, no matter the cost.

The High Heel Heroine's Martial Melody was a song of revenge, a melody that echoed through the streets of Liang. It was a tale of a woman who had learned to blend her martial prowess with the elegance of her high heels, a unique blend that both amused and terrified the locals.

Li's journey began in the seedy underbelly of the city, where whispers of corruption and power played like a sinister symphony. She knew that to uncover the truth, she would have to navigate a web of deceit and betrayal. Her first target was the local magistrate, a man known for his iron fist and even more ironclad silence.

The High Heel Heroine approached the magistrate's residence with a calculated step, her heels clicking a rhythm that was as much a warning as it was a challenge. She knew the guards would be on high alert, but her presence alone was enough to unsettle them. She entered the courtyard with a poise that belied the danger she felt in her chest.

Inside, the air was thick with the scent of incense and the sound of distant whispers. Li moved with the grace of a cat, her eyes scanning the room for any sign of her mentor's accuser. She found him, seated at a table, surrounded by a coterie of sycophants. His eyes flickered with recognition, but he did not speak.

The High Heel Heroine approached him, her movements slow and deliberate. "I am here to set the record straight," she said, her voice a soft whisper that carried the weight of a thousand words. "Your lies will not stand, and your silence will be your undoing."

The man's face turned pale, and he tried to rise, but Li's swift kick sent him sprawling back into his chair. She did not give him time to recover. "You will tell the truth, or I will make sure your silence is the last thing you ever hear."

The man's eyes widened in fear as he began to speak, his voice trembling with each word. The High Heel Heroine listened, her expression unreadable. When he finished, she nodded. "Thank you," she said, and with a swift, graceful motion, she left the room.

Her next target was the city's most powerful businessman, a man who had been rumored to have his fingers in every pie. Li knew he was the mastermind behind her mentor's downfall, and she was determined to bring him to justice.

She entered his grand estate, a place of opulence and excess, where the rich and powerful gathered to feast and plot. Li moved through the crowd with ease, her high heels clicking a rhythm that was both a challenge and a warning. She found him in the garden, surrounded by his cronies, discussing business in hushed tones.

Li approached him, her presence commanding the attention of the room. "You have been a busy man," she said, her voice cutting through the air like a knife. "It's time for you to pay for your transgressions."

The businessman looked up, his face a mask of shock and fear. "Who are you?" he demanded, his voice trembling.

"I am the High Heel Heroine," she replied, her voice cold and steady. "And I am here to even the score."

The businessman tried to rise, but Li's swift kick sent him sprawling to the ground. She stood over him, her eyes narrowing. "You will face the justice you have denied so many others."

With a swift motion, Li delivered a series of precise strikes that left the businessman gasping for breath. He was a powerful man, but before her martial arts prowess and the elegance of her high heels, he was nothing more than a man who had overstepped his bounds.

Li left the estate, her mission nearly complete. She had exposed the truth and brought justice to her mentor. But as she walked the streets of Liang, she couldn't shake the feeling that there was something more to this story. She knew that her quest for revenge was far from over, and that the High Heel Heroine's Martial Melody was still playing in her mind.

The High Heel Heroine's journey was far from over. She had uncovered the truth, but the shadows of Liang were still deep and dark. She would need all her martial arts skills and the grace of her high heels to navigate the treacherous waters ahead. And as she continued her quest, the people of Liang watched, their eyes filled with a mix of fear and admiration. For the High Heel Heroine was not just a woman seeking revenge; she was a symbol of hope in a world where justice was often a distant dream.
